linesize说明
#define AV_NUM_DATA_POINTERS 8 /** * For video, size in bytes of each picture line. * For audio, size in bytes of each plane. * * For audio, only linesize[0] may be set. For planar audio, each channel * plane must be the same size. * * For video the linesizes should be multiples of the CPUs alignment * preference, this is 16 or 32 for modern desktop CPUs. * Some code requires such alignment other code can be slower without * correct alignment, for yet other it makes no difference. * * @note The linesize may be larger than the size of usable data -- there * may be extra padding present for performance reasons. */ int linesize[AV_NUM_DATA_POINTERS];
计算linesize
/** * Fill plane linesizes for an image with pixel format pix_fmt and * width width. * * @param linesizes array to be filled with the linesize for each plane * @return >= 0 in case of success, a negative error code otherwise */ int av_image_fill_linesizes(int linesizes[4], enum AVPixelFormat pix_fmt, int width) { int i, ret; const AVPixFmtDescriptor *desc = av_pix_fmt_desc_get(pix_fmt); int max_step [4]; /* max pixel step for each plane */ int max_step_comp[4]; /* the component for each plane which has the max pixel step */ memset(linesizes, 0, 4*sizeof(linesizes[0])); if (!desc || desc->flags & AV_PIX_FMT_FLAG_HWACCEL) return AVERROR(EINVAL); av_image_fill_max_pixsteps(max_step, max_step_comp, desc); for (i = 0; i < 4; i++) { if ((ret = image_get_linesize(width, i, max_step[i], max_step_comp[i], desc)) < 0) return ret; linesizes[i] = ret; } return 0; } /** * Get the required buffer size for the given audio parameters. * * @param[out] linesize calculated linesize, may be NULL * @param nb_channels the number of channels * @param nb_samples the number of samples in a single channel * @param sample_fmt the sample format * @param align buffer size alignment (0 = default, 1 = no alignment) * @return required buffer size, or negative error code on failure */ int av_samples_get_buffer_size(int *linesize, int nb_channels, int nb_samples, enum AVSampleFormat sample_fmt, int align) { int line_size; int sample_size = av_get_bytes_per_sample(sample_fmt); int planar = av_sample_fmt_is_planar(sample_fmt); /* validate parameter ranges */ if (!sample_size || nb_samples <= 0 || nb_channels <= 0) return AVERROR(EINVAL); /* auto-select alignment if not specified */ if (!align) { if (nb_samples > INT_MAX - 31) return AVERROR(EINVAL); align = 1; nb_samples = FFALIGN(nb_samples, 32); } /* check for integer overflow */ if (nb_channels > INT_MAX / align || (int64_t)nb_channels * nb_samples > (INT_MAX - (align * nb_channels)) / sample_size) return AVERROR(EINVAL); line_size = planar ? FFALIGN(nb_samples * sample_size, align) : FFALIGN(nb_samples * sample_size * nb_channels, align); if (linesize) *linesize = line_size; return planar ? line_size * nb_channels : line_size; }
